Preparation of p-isopropylphenol by selective oxidation of p-di-isopropylbenzene
Abstract 1. A method was developed for preparing p-isopropylphenol by oxidation of p-di-isopropylbenzene with a monohydroperoxide yield of 90%. 2. In acidic decomposition of monohydroperoxide of p-di-isoprophybenzene in the presence of cation exchange resins p-isopropylphenol yield was 98–99%. Kinetic studies of acidic decomposition of monohydroperoxide of p-di-isoprophylbezene show that the rate of acidic decompositon in the presence of catalysts containing a nitro-group is doubled.
